Information Services & Technology (IS&T) would like to notify MIT computing
community about serious multiplication Bug in Excel 2007 which causes
incorrect multiplication results in spreadsheets.
The multiplication bug was initially reported in on-line PC Magazine on
September 25, 2007. Here is a link to the article:
http://www.pcmag.com/article2/0,1895,2188504,00.asp
IS&T has received a confirmation from Microsoft that there is a bug in Excel
and they are working on a hotfix. The timeline for a hotfix is not yet
known. IS&T is working with Microsoft on getting updated information on this
issue. We will notify the MIT community when there is a fix to this problem.
